The grammar manual of the Romanian language aims, from a scientific point of view, to promote it information updated by GALR. The grammar of the Romanian language. I. The word; II. The statement (2005, 2008), coord. Valeria Gutu Romalo (elaborated under the aegis of the Institute of Linguistics „Iorgu Jordan - Al. Rosetti ”from Bucharest of the Romanian Academy). Theoretically, the volume promotes the updated information, the theoretical assertions proposed in the mentioned sources as well as in the literature of the last decades, in general.
From the perspective of applied linguistics, the Handbook is a useful tool that emphasizes the fundamental role of cognitive models in the process of knowing and learning the language Romanian, by non-native speakers and / or natives. Even a single argument would suffice this sense: grammar is the mathematics of a language, abstract, complex, and formation communication skills are not achieved ad hoc, through random exercises. It means a long elaborated process, whose purpose is to consolidate logical thinking in accessing linguistic information. Strengthening logical thinking is fundamental, whether we consider it general aspects or particular aspects of the Romanian language. Training of skills correct use of the plural number (use of plural endings depending on gender, the use of vowel and consonant alternations), for example, becomes a special process complex for an English speaker (where the plural is formed by adding termination - s, with the necessary exceptions), of a binding language (where the plural is formed by attaching a distinct plural suffix, at the end of the word) etc. etymology to the nouns of the Romanian language, neologisms, semantics of the name etc. add new elements of difficulty in the correct use of the plural of the Romanian language, by foreign students. Of these considerations, the volume proposes several sets of grammar exercises - training a the competences of the agreement in Romanian, at the level of the nominal group - organized on the basis of ten cognitive, theoretical and applied models, regarding the formation of the plural of nouns, a gender, oblique cases, competent to form nouns by conversion, primary determination and agreement of different types of article and adjective (adjective proper, pronominal adjective, postverbal adjectives) with the noun etc. It is a perfectible model, without the claim to be exhaustive, whose purpose is the formation of communication skills.
